Comments (12)touchadream, you have a wonderful concept plan going already, so I won't pitch you for my time--but I will say that you might be wish to deal with the floor and backsplash first. With the room well in place, the lighting can become just the right finishing touch. But, I find that selecting fixtures earlier works best if the rest of the plan is less fixed. In that case, you would be selecting items to riff off the fixtures (and cabinets). In your case, you want a fixture that riffs off the decorative collection you describe. Don't give up hope--at the same time I was placing two 14,000 euro chandeliers in a foyer, I found $19 CAD pendants for a kitchen -- each effective because the lighting "fit". Comments (1)Based on your description this sounds "do-able". To replace the pendants with recessed fixtures you will need to do some patching and painting, as the box for a surface mounted light is quite small and for recessed fixtures are much larger. They are also usually mounted to the framing differently. If you are putting the new recessed lights in an insulated ceiling you will also need to make sure that you by and IC rated fixture (insulated). One thing I would recommend for the recessed lights is to check with your vendor on the beam spread (photometrics). Since the purpose of these lights will be to illuminate the island, a general purpose fixture may be too broad. You may need something more like a pin-spot to do the trick. https://www.houzz.com/photos/hillside-house-contemporary-kitchen-san-francisco-phvw-vp~41858717 Best of luck, Marc A.
